Example Project Assessment Summary

Program: Physical Sciences Learning Outcomes Assessed During This Period: Show the ability to effectively utilize computational tools for collecting, analyzing, and interpreting data in a real world setting. Findings: Students met, but didn't beat learning assessment expectations. It was found that students in physics performed better than students in chemistry despite sharing the same data collection classes.

Students in physics have completed 2 additional classes at this stage in their major that focus on real world analysis. All students performed at expectations on data analysis, but data collection and interpretation were at or slightly below objectives. Conclusion: Students within the chemistry major complete fewer classes that relate to real world analysis, and appear to have sparse experience with data collection.

Surveys of students indicated that chemistry students felt less confident in their knowledge. Test scores on application tests confirmed that the chemistry track appeared far less prepared than the physics track. These findings held when adjusted for overall grade point average to account for differences in student learning between majors.

Chemistry professors surveyed did not appear to understand the importance of their role in the outcome. Physics professors appeared to support the assessment process and beliefs. It is possible that this played a role in the outcome.

Recommendations: Require an additional class focused on experimentation, with projects that mimic real life data collection and analysis methodologies. Develop mandatory workshop for chemistry faculty to describe and promote involvement in educational assessment, especially as it relates to chemistry. Survey students to better understand their belief systems about chemistry as a major.

See if there are additional learning styles or issues that need to be addressed to combat the lower test scores.
